The RoleThe Product Management Director - Visualization and UI/UX is a key strategic role at DGM responsible for driving product strategy and execution for DGMs Visualization Suite, encompassing all facets of visualization features within the monarch system. This spans the core visualization product, System Explorer along with Advanced Tabulars, Voyager, Design Studio and the OpenViewNET client. In addition to responsibility for the various visualization products, this leader is responsible for driving the continual improvement and evolution of the user interface and user experience across all product suites. The Product Management Applications Director will work with a variety of Digital Grid Management (DGM) stakeholders to drive successful product initiatives, drive meaningful change in the usability of the software and lead customer advisory events where product managers work closely with customer advisory groups to solicit feedback, perform proof of concept work and drive product roadmaps.
